Charlene comes to GreenSquare Center for the Healing Arts with 15 years of research and work in the rapidly emerging field of Complementary and Alternative Medicine.
Her experience and education have been unique and varied, including:
• Northwestern University McGaw Medical Center nursing graduate, with subsequent practice in a variety of specialties throughout the U.S.
• Physician's practice management for nutrition in cancer care
• “Cancer Guides” comprehensive training in Integrative Oncology and “Food As Medicine” through The Center for Mind-Body Medicine, Washington, D.C., in conjunction with The University of Minnesota and Georgetown University School of Medicine
• Nutrition Response Testing, Ulan Nutritional Systems
• Lobbyist for Freedom of Health Care Choice, Government Accountability Board, Madison, WI
• Duke Integrative Medicine, Professional Health Coaching Graduate

The Duke University Model for Integrative Medicine places “You”, the patient/client at the center of health care decision making and encourages addressing and developing all aspects of a person, encompassing physical, mental, social and spiritual well-being.
